    Formulas Required

    • Spend Variance: =Budget_Allocated - Budget_Spent (Action Plan)
    • Conversion Rate: =IF(Clicks>0, Sales_Generated/Clicks, 0) (Channel Tracker)
    • ROI %: =IF(Cost>0, ((Sales_Generated - Cost)/Cost)*100, 0) (Channel Tracker)
    • Total Budget Used: =SUM(ActionPlan!D:D) (Executive Summary)
    • Projected ROI: =AVERAGEIF(ChannelTracker!B:B, “Social Media”, ChannelTracker!J:J) – for channel-specific projections.
    • Status Color Indicator: Uses nested IF to return “On Track”, “At Risk”, or “Off Track” based on variance thresholds.

    Conditional Formatting

    • Red fill for Budget Spent > 110% of Allocation (Action Plan)
    • Yellow fill for Variance between -10% to +10%
    • Green fill when Status = “Completed” and ROI > 200%
    • Status column uses icon sets: green checkmark, yellow clock, red X
